Abstract
For controlling quality of products, there are two things we have to consider; how to measure the quality and how to improve it. The former is discussed in section 2 by introducing the difference in quality levels between Japan and USA. After briefly introducing all countermeasures for improving quality of products, an on-line quality control system design is proposed as the one which is more economical than removing defec- tives after manufacturing by conducting inspection. It has been ma?y Japanese companies' policy to keep pro- cess conditions at best in order to produce uniform products as far as possible. This paper discusses the optimum feed-back process control system design by checking either quality characteristics or process pa- rameters after introducing overall quality countermea- sures starting with product design.
